    4 is the correct answer This is a bare minimum for variety. I typically have between 10 - 12 but find with that many, I don't play some of them as often as I should. However, I think a very comfortable number is 8 because as anyone in this hobby knows - there is always something breaking so you can assume you will always have something unplayable.

    Seriously though, you will have to collect for a while until you determine the right number for you.

    The answer of course depends on the OP's spouse, available space, bank
    account and preferences.

    My approach is a bit different from most as I'm into the history and
    development of pins over the years. As a result I have games built
    as early as 1931 and well into the 1990's. And everything in between. Its a kick to play a
    mechanical pinball machine with real pins (nails) then play ST:TNG.
    Don't think I've ever been bored with my pins.
